Nizamabad: Farmers want revival of sugar mills as election issue

Nizamabad: Sugarcane farmers in Nizamabad have decided to make the revival of sugar factories an election issue.

Two major sugar mills in the district namely Nizam Sugar Factory aka Nizam Deccan Sugar Limited (NDSL) in Bodhan and Nizamabad Co-operative Sugar Factory (NCSF) at Sarangapur have been closed since 2008 and farmers are staging protest to revive these mills.

According to the news report published in The New Indian Express, during the 2019 General Elections, Nizamabad MP Dharmapuri Arvind raised the issue and got benefit and, other parties too are keen on tapping the issue.

The meeting of farmers and stakeholders of NCSF convened a meeting to discuss the revival of the sugar mills, which was attended by former minister Mandava Venkateshwar Rao who extended support to them.
